The effects of high energy ultrasound and slightly raised temperature combined with the denaturing action of dimethylsulphoxide on the molecular weight and higher‐order structure of hyaluronans and some β‐(1→3)‐glucans were studied by means of size exclusion chromatography (SEC) technique. Some experimental conditions connected with the (bio‐)polymer sample preparation prior to its SEC analysis are overviewed in the light of informational relevance of studies where the action of a physical and/or chemical agent changes the hydrodynamic size of the macrobiomolecule.
